Why This Heatwave Matters: Context and Background
Understanding this event requires looking beyond the immediate meteorology.
- A Pattern of Escalation: This heatwave is not an anomaly but part of a clear, decades-long trend. Europe has warmed significantly faster than the global average. Studies consistently show that human-caused climate change has made such intense excessive heat events several times more likely to occur and has increased their peak intensity.
- The "Omega Block": Meteorologists often attribute such persistent heatwaves to a weather pattern called an "omega block," where a high-pressure system becomes stationary, acting like a lid on a pot, trapping hot air and deflecting cooler weather systems. While these patterns occur naturally, climate change is thought to make them more persistent and severe.
- Cultural and Infrastructure Lag: As highlighted by the BBC's reporting, many European nations are playing catch-up. Infrastructure, urban planning, building codes, and even cultural habits (like the late-night European dinner) were designed for a cooler climate. The rapid onset of these extreme events exposes critical vulnerabilities. France's debate over air conditioning is a microcosm of a continent-wide challenge: how to retrofit 20th-century society for 21st-century climate realities.
The Scorching Reality: Immediate Effects Across Society
The impacts of this excessive heat event are multidimensional and severe.
- Public Health Crisis: Extreme heat is the deadliest weather-related phenomenon in many countries. Hospitals see a surge in heatstroke, dehydration, and respiratory problems. The strain is particularly acute for the elderly and those with pre-existing conditions. The "heat-trap" homes described by The Guardian directly contribute to fatalities by trapping dangerous heat indoors.
- Infrastructure Under Duress: Transportation networks buckle; rails warp, tarmac melts, and flight schedules are disrupted. Energy grids face immense demand for cooling, risking blackouts. Water resources are depleted, leading to restrictions and impacting agriculture.
- Agricultural and Environmental Impact: Crops wither under the heat and lack of rain, threatening food supplies and increasing prices. The risk of devastating wildfires, like those seen in recent years, escalates dramatically. Ecosystems are stressed, with aquatic life affected by warming rivers and lakes.
- The Social Fracture: As reported, the burden is not shared equally. Those without access to cooling, living in vulnerable housing, or working outdoors are disproportionately affected, bringing issues of environmental justice and equity to the forefront.
